August 8, 2025 - A fire ban is in effect for the entire County of Elgin – which includes Bayham. All burn permits are now suspended and any open-air/recreational fires are prohibited. See the NOTICE from the County of Elgin for further information.

Children's programming is offered at the Marine Museum each summer for a period of six (6) weeks in July and August.
The 2025 Program will be held on Tuesdays from 1pm to 2pm starting on July 8th through to August 12th.
This year's theme is 'GET TO KNOW NATURE!'

Bayham offers a curbside bulk garbage pick up service within the months of April, May, July, September and October.
*Registration and a fee of $25 is required at least 1 week prior to the pick up date.*
This month's pick up is scheduled for Monday, July 14, with registration being Tuesday, July 8.
